Expandable magnetic tankbag with 7 1/2" x 13" map pocket. Has multiple uses since the top portion unzips easily and conveniently from magnetic base to serve as an "on the go" backpack. Includes rain cover. Also has a built in carry handle.

Magnetic base also contains a large 9" x 13" map pocket.
10"x15"x7". 16-liter volume. Black, good condition but somewhat faded from usage (see picture).

Fits many super-sportbikes with wide, flat steel tanks.
